The inclusion model promotes special education studentsâ right to participate in a general education classroom. These classes are often co-taught by a general education and special education teacher, and also typically have additional support staff involved in the caseload of kids. WebInclusion in education is an approach to educating students with special educational needs. Under the inclusion model, students with special needs spend most or all of their time with non-disabled students. Implementation of these practices varies. Schools most frequently use them for selected students with mild to severe special needs.
